Dual USB-C Ports Overview

Nomad’s 65W Dual USB-C Adapter features two versatile USB-C ports for charging multiple devices simultaneously. The adapter is a powerhouse with each port capable of delivering up to 65W of power output.

Here are three key points about the dual USB-C ports on the Nomad Apple Watch Charger:

  • Power Output: The top port provides a robust 45W of power, catering to high-power devices like laptops, while the bottom port offers 20W, perfect for smartphones and other gadgets, ensuring efficient charging for all your devices.
  • ProCharge Technology: Designed with ProCharge technology, the adapter intelligently distributes power to connected devices, optimizing charging speeds and efficiency.
  • Apple Watch Fast Charger: In addition to the dual USB-C ports, the adapter includes a built-in Apple Watch Fast Charger (MFi certified), allowing users to conveniently charge their Apple Watch alongside other devices.

Fast-Charging Capabilities Explained

With cutting-edge technology and efficient power distribution, the 65W Dual USB-C Adapter excels in providing rapid charging speeds for the Apple Watch and other devices. Featuring fast-charging capabilities, this adapter delivers 65W of power output specifically tailored for the Apple Watch.

The inclusion of ProCharge technology enables the adapter to either provide the full 65W power through one port or split it into 45W from the top port and 20W from the bottom, allowing for simultaneous charging of two devices.

Moreover, the adapter incorporates GaN technology, ensuring not only high efficiency but also a compact design perfect for travelers and individuals on the go. Designed to support all Apple Watch charging protocols, it guarantees a reliable and stable power supply while preventing overcharging and overheating.

Additionally, the adapter is equipped with various safety features such as overcurrent, short-circuit, and overvoltage protection, meeting stringent safety standards to offer worry-free charging experiences.
